EC Martin is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, EC Martin has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 436 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 7 papers in Surgery and 3 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in EC Martin's work include Gallbladder and Bile Duct Disorders (6 papers), Congenital Heart Disease Studies (3 papers) and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(3 papers). EC Martin is often cited by papers focused on Gallbladder and Bile Duct Disorders (6 papers), Congenital Heart Disease Studies (3 papers) and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(3 papers). EC Martin collaborates with scholars based in United States, Spain and France. EC Martin's co-authors include WJ Casarella, William J. Casarella, Norman G. Diamond, Michael Behan, Elias Kazam, Stéphane Kremer, F. Veillon, S. Riehm, Voorhees Ab and Griepp Rb and has published in prestigious journals such as Radiology, American Journal of Roentgenology and American Journal of Neuroradiology.
